Clean lenses start with clean hands. Before touching your contacts, wash thoroughly with soap and water, then dry them with a lint-free towel. This simple habit reduces the chance of introducing bacteria to your eyes, which can lead to irritation or infection.
If you wear reusable lenses, clean and store them only with the recommended solution—never water. For daily disposables, remember that “one day” truly means one day. Reusing them can reduce oxygen flow to the eye and increase the risk of discomfort or dryness.
Even if your contacts feel fine, regular eye exams near you are essential. Over time, subtle changes in your prescription or corneal shape can affect how your lenses fit. During your exam, Dr. Urias, your trusted optometrist near you, checks not only your vision but also the overall health of your eyes, including the cornea and tear film.
Routine visits allow your optometrist to catch early signs of dryness, allergies, or other conditions that may make contact wear less comfortable.
Your eyes need oxygen to stay healthy. If you notice redness, burning, or blurred vision after long hours of wear, it might be time to take a break. Give your eyes at least a few hours each day without lenses—especially before bed—to let them recover. Using hydrating drops approved for contact lens wear can also help relieve dryness.
